When you are in a situation that is making you angry, ask yourself these questions:
How important is this problem really? Is it worth getting angry about?
Is there some way of solving the problem that does not involve getting angry?
Would getting angry actually help to solve this problem anyway?
In most cases, you will find that anger is not the answer.

The goal of anger management is to reduce negative feelings. This can help reduce the negative physiological changes caused by anger. Like other emotions, anger can cause physiological changes such as a rise in blood pressure, and an increase in your energy hormones like adrenaline.

Anger management is referred to as methods or techniques to eliminate or reduce the effects, triggers and degrees of an otherwise uncontrollable emotional anger state. Anger at workplace can be a serious issue regarding the performance of an employee and his/her colleagues. A person with uncontrollable anger can not only be a threat to himself but to his co workers as well.
